Dynamic analysis of piles and pile groups embedded in homogeneous soils

摘要:

AbstractA boundary element formulation for the dynamic analysis of axially and laterally loaded single piles and pile groups is presented. The piles are represented by compressible beam‐column elements and the soil as a hysteretic elastic half‐space. The governing equations of motion for the pile domain have been solved exactly for distributed periodic loading intensities. These solutions are then coupled with a numerical solution for the motion of the soil domain by satisfying equilibrium and compatibility at the pile‐soil interface.
